Farmers Market 5/22

Overcast, and a little cooler…raspberries are in, and baby summer squash. A few pictures from the vendor’s viewpoint, thanks to Amy Hicks and the sticky bun lady. It was an early day for me; most people don’t realize how hard these vendors, especially the produce, bakers, coffee makers have to work…starting well before dawn, often driving through the darkness to start setting up at 6:30…Often a nine hour day before noon. Don’t forget the park staff who are out checking trash cans, fire lanes, getting the market ready.

Thanks to all who make this market important to so many.
